TL;DR: In this paper, a model for mass exchange in a single spray bank scrubber was developed and the relation for mass transfer units with respect to parameters characterizing dispersed and continuous phases was determined.
Abstract: On the basis of the model for aerodynamic characteristics of a FGD spray tower, a model for mass exchange in a single spray bank scrubber was developed. The relation for mass transfer units with respect to parameters characterizing dispersed and continuous phases was determined. Predictions of the scrubber efficiency for very fast and very slow reaction rates in the slurry are presented and discussed. The influence of sulfur dioxide concentration in gas and slurry feeds on the absorption efficiency are shown. A qualitative comparison with experimental data presented in the literature was performed.

TL;DR: In this article, an alkali liquor spray tower with the lower portion provided with a waste gas inlet and the top provided with waste gas outlet, and a condenser connected with the waste gas outlets is used for treating organic waste gas generated in the recycling process of a power lithium battery.
Abstract: The invention provides a device and method for treating organic waste gas generated in the recycling process of a power lithium battery and relates to the technical field of battery waste gas treatment. The device comprises an alkali liquor spray tower with the lower portion provided with a waste gas inlet and the top provided with a waste gas outlet, and a condenser connected with the waste gas outlet. The waste gas inlet is connected with a cyclone separator for separating a gas phase and a solid phase in the organic gas. The condenser is connected with an active carbon storage tank I and an active carbon storage tank II for adsorbing the waste gas through pipelines. The active carbon storage tank I and the active carbon storage tank II are connected in parallel and then sequentially connected with a filter, a vacuum pump and a gas-water separation tank through pipelines. The gas-water separation tank is connected with the condenser. The device for treating the waste gas includes the steps of gas dust removal, alkali liquor spray washing, gas condensation and pressure swing adsorption. The device and method save energy, and are economical, simple in process and high in purification efficiency.

TL;DR: The results suggest that the spray-cycle reactor is useful to oxygen-demanding fermentation because of the high k1a value in comparison with the stirred-tank reactor.
Abstract: A highly efficient spray-cycle reactor for oxygen supply was developed. A typical arrangement of the reactor consists of a spray column fitted with a nozzle and a coaxal tube, and a reservoir vessel. The culture broth was circulated between the column and vessel by a peristaltic pump. The volumetric oxygen-transfer coefficient, k1a was evaluated as a parameter for oxygen supply. The liquid circulation rate in the spraycycle reactor was represented in terms of the number of circulations. The k1a value increased as the number of circulations increased, reaching 208 h-1 at 4.4 min-1 of circulation numbers. This value was 1.8 times higher than that in a 1500-mL stirred-tank reactor under the agitation of 20.7g and the aeration of 1.0 volume per min.

TL;DR: In this article, the authors proposed a utility model for flue gas cleaning, recycling and reusing system, which is simple and reasonable in structure and low in operating cost and is used for converting waste gas into inert gases after sulfur removal, dust removal and haze reduction.
Abstract: The utility model relates to a flue gas cleaning, recycling and reusing system, and belongs to the technical field of flue gas cleaning, recycling and reusing. The utility model aims to provide the flue gas cleaning, recycling and reusing system which is simple and reasonable in structure and low in operating cost and used for converting waste flue gas into inert gases after sulfur removal, dust removal and haze reduction. With the adopted technical scheme, an air outlet of an induced draft fan is communicated with a spray tower through a first pipeline; a smoke outlet at the top of the spray tower is connected with the pipeline of a Roots blower; an air outlet of the Roots blower is communicated with an air cooler through a second pipeline; an air outlet of the air cooler is connected with the pipeline of a coal storage silo; the spray tower is provided with a circulating cooling-water machine, a water inlet of the circulating cooling-water machine is connected with a liquid box at the bottom of the spray tower; a water outlet of the circulating cooling-water machine is communicated with an atomizer of the spray tower; the liquid box of the spray tower is internally provided with a pH value sensor. The flue gas cleaning, recycling and reusing system is energy-saving and environmentally friendly, and is widely applied to cleaning, recycling and reusing of waste flue gas.
